I now have just over 600 rounds through my 9mm compact. I sort of bought it on a whim. The sale price was good and the rebate and 2 free mags didn't hurt. I figured I shoot it once and a while and maybe even sell the free mags. I already have a Glock 26 so had a gun to fill the compact niche. But...since my first trip to the range with the M&P it's the only 9mm I've taken on my last 3 or 4 range trips. The thing is downright surgically accurate. I've had only 1 malfunction, at around the 500 or 550 round count. A round failed to chamber fully and left the slide slightly out of battery. Pulled the trigger and nothing happened because the trigger had not reset. I ejected the chambered round and found the rim of the round was a bit chewed up. Not sure what happened but I'm not too worried about it at this point. It functioned flawlessly through the rest of the time at the range.



I almost broke down and bought a full size 9mm today. A nearby store had them for $399 + 2 mags + the rebate. Seemed too good to pass up but I didn't give in. If I didn't already have a Glock 19 (close enough in size to the M&P) I would have grabbed it up. I'm sure I'll regret not buying it, some time around tomorrow morning.

Similar Story

I too bought a 9c mainly because I've heard such great reports on it on this forum and others. Found a new one at a show in Texas for $399 so said what the heck and bought it. Much like Funyet, my concealed carry gun is a Glock 27; but I wanted a 9mm carry gun as well as the .40. Just got back from the range. The trigger is manageable and easily staged. The 9c was totally reliable thru 400 rounds of fact. JHP reloads, Winchester white box JHPs and Corbon 115gr JHPs. Recoil is pretty much a nonfactor and the gun is more accurate than my G27 @ 7 and 10 yards. Sure is neat to take one out of the box and be so impressed with it! Especially since the Ruger SR9 I purchased last month made it through 40 rounds before the mag catch failed.



Now I see why most on this forum are such fans.
